Now that you’ve broken free from your Ipad account, it’s time to explore new digital platforms and services that offer a more secure and private experience. Here are some alternatives to consider:
– Secure Messaging Apps: Apps like Signal and Wire offer end-to-end encryption and a focus on user security.
– Private Browsers: Browsers like Tor and Brave provide a more anonymous and secure browsing experience.
– Secure Cloud Storage: Services like Tresorit and pCloud offer secure cloud storage options with robust encryption and access controls.
